Boosted Protease Inhibitors – Essential Guide

When working with Boosted Protease Inhibitors, a class of HIV medicines paired with a pharmacokinetic booster to raise drug levels and improve viral control. Also called PI boosting, they sit at the heart of modern antiretroviral therapy. This approach boosted protease inhibitors enhances efficacy while often lowering pill count.

Key to the strategy is a booster that blocks the liver enzyme CYP3A4, slowing the breakdown of the protease inhibitor. The first‑generation booster, Ritonavir, a potent CYP3A inhibitor originally developed as an antiviral, is still widely used because it’s cheap and well‑studied. Newer options like Cobicistat, a purpose‑built booster that has no standalone antiviral activity offer cleaner side‑effect profiles. Together they require careful dosing schedules and routine lab monitoring to keep viral loads suppressed.

What You Need to Know Before Starting

Boosted protease inhibitors influence many other drugs, so a thorough medication review is a must. Common interactions involve statins, anticoagulants, and certain antibiotics—each can either spike or drop the inhibitor’s level. Patients also need to watch for metabolic side effects such as increased cholesterol, triglycerides, and insulin resistance, which are tracked during quarterly visits. Resistance is less common when adherence is high, but missed doses can let the virus adapt, so counseling on strict timing is crucial.

From a practical standpoint, the regimen simplifies to one or two pills a day for many patients, a big win over older, multi‑tablet schedules. Clinicians often combine a boosted protease inhibitor with two nucleos(t)ide reverse transcriptase inhibitors to form a complete three‑drug backbone. This triple regimen covers the virus from multiple angles, reducing the chance of breakthrough.
